CNS Excitability Regulation

Meaning

CNS Excitability Regulation refers to the clinical and physiological management of the balance between excitatory and inhibitory neurotransmission within the central nervous system (CNS). Maintaining this delicate equilibrium is crucial for preventing conditions like seizures, anxiety disorders, and chronic stress responses. Optimal regulation ensures stable neuronal firing rates, supporting cognitive clarity and emotional resilience.
